Kuramdasu Srinivasu, v. The State Of Andhra Pradesh, Rep. By Its Principal Secretary
HON'BLE SRI JUSTICE S.V. BHATT Writ Petition No.24514 of 2017 ORDER:
At request of the Assistant Government Pleader (Revenue), the writ petition has been directed to be taken up today for admission.
2. The Assistant Government Pleader has received instructions from the 4th respondent. As per the instructions, the subject matter of the writ petition is assigned land and the petitioner is in possession of the assigned land, contrary to assignment conditions and Act 9 of 1977. According to him, notices were already issued and action will be taken in accordance with law.
3. Mr. Ramana Allu appearing for petitioner contends that following the procedure does not mean perfunctory adherence to requirements of law. The procedure said to have been followed by 3rd respondent at any given point of time must substantially satisfy the requirements of the procedure so that the rights of parties by participating in such enquiry are not adversely affected.
4. On the defective issue of notices, he relied upon the decision in 'Sudalagunt a Sugars Limit ed vs. Joint Collect or, Chit t oor 1'. He draws the attention of the court to the notice issued in Form II dated 26.02.2016. Keeping in view of the ratio laid down by this court in the above decision and also to avoid delay or irregularity in the conduct of enquiry, learned Assistant Government Pleader consents to set aside the notice dated 26.02.2016 and give liberty to 4th respondent to strictly proceed in accordance with law. The statement is placed on record. The notice dated 26.02.2016 is set aside, as illegal and the 4th respondent is 1 2017(1) ALT 499
given liberty, if circumstances warrant, to proceed against the alleged possession and enjoyment of the petitioner, contrary to breach of Assignment conditions and Act 9 of 1977. The possession of the petitioner, it is needless to observe, cannot and could not be disturbed in the interregnum.
5. The writ petition is ordered accordingly. No order as to costs. Pending miscellaneous petitions if any in this writ petition shall stand dismissed in consequence.
